White Sox Visit La Rabida Children's Hospital
Chicago White Sox team members brought the ballpark atmosphere to patients at La Rabida Children's Hospital as part of Sox Serve Week.
CHICAGO, IL - A few Chicago White Sox players visited and interacted with patients at La Rabida Children’s Hospital on the South Side earlier this week. Four players, play-by-play broadcaster Jason Benetti and members of the White Sox Volunteer Corps met with the patients as part of Sox Serve Week, an annual community outreach and fundraising campaign in its 10th year.
Players Matt Davidson, Reynaldo López, Yoán Moncada and Charlie Tilson brought the ballpark atmosphere to the patients on Tuesday, showing up in their 1983 throwback jerseys. Scroll through the photos at the top of this article for a look back at the team's visit to the hospital.
Sox Serve Week, sponsored in part by Beggars Pizza, Goose Island Beer Co., Guaranteed Rate, Magellan Corporation, Proven IT, United Airlines and Wintrust Community Banks, ran from June 11-16 and also included team members giving one fan the ultimate White Sox experience and performing random acts of kindness throughout the city.
